As a mom, I'm always amazed by how closely my kids watch what I do. Every so often I'll have to fast for medical tests and my 4 year old 100% notices. She'll even bring it up months after the fact, so not only does she notice, but it leaves an impression. If you think your kids don't notice that you're dieting, eating different foods than they are, or not eating when they eat, you need to think again. According to a study by Lowes & Tiggemann (2003), kids as young as 5 are no...t only aware that their parents are unsatisfied with their bodies, but they are also aware that their parents use dieting as a way to "fix" the problem. I can't really believe that it's already December. This year B is at an age where Christmas and Santa are a big deal, so the countdown is on. This year we've opted to not do the traditional chocolate advent calendar and instead we're filling Santa's beard with cotton balls. When his beard is full, he visits! Now you may be thinking, of course you're not doing chocolate, you're a dietitian, do your kids even eat chocolate? And to that I say, heck yes we do. In fact, in our hou...se, when B has chocolate, it's part of her main meal. Like all foods in our house, if chocolate is on the menu (i.e. part of the meal), she's able to eat however much she wants. Does this end up with her eating only chocolate for a meal? Sometimes. But in doing this, we are teaching her that chocolate doesn't need to be put on a pedestal. Requiring kids to eat their vegetables to get a treat can reinforce that vegetables are bad/yucky and chocolate is the prize you get after suffering through them. This is why the one-a-day chocolate advent calendar doesn't really work in our house. She's still a bit young to understand the difference between a one-a-day chocolate countdown and the usual way we eat chocolate. Plus she's actually really enjoying the cotton balls. Each day we add a new one and she gets to count down how many more we have to add before it's full. For the past 7 months, baby O and I have had to follow a strict dairy and soy-free diet due to a suspected cows milk protein allergy. As someone who practices intuitive eating and doesn't restrict her diet in any way, this was a challenge. At first, I felt grief that I couldn't eat all the foods that I liked/was accustomed to. I also had strange cravings and felt weird compulsions to eat foods that were safe but weren't foods I would normally snack on (like pepperoni ). I...t took a few days to settle in and find alternative foods that we could use for general cooking, as well as snacks that I enjoyed eating and gave me some food freedom. 7 months in, I can say that I can fully honour my hunger, but the medical dietary restrictions definitely add another layer to intuitive eating. That being said, it's definitely possible, and I feel like this has given me some insight into what clients face when they want to eat intuitively but have other medical conditions like diabetes, high blood pressure, IBS etc. We weren't given a ton of direction when we had to cut dairy and soy aside from a list of ingredients to look for, so if you need to go dairy and/or soy-free, here are some things I've learned: - Read labels! So many foods contain dairy and soy. A few surprises for us were wine, beef broth, most bread, crackers, and medications (including vitamin D drops) - Start with the basics. A good milk and butter substitute allowed us to basically eat normally. We were able to substitute what we needed to into recipes that we already enjoyed. It can be overwhelming to have to look for all new recipes and ingredients, so keep it simple. - Review what you already cook. For us, meals like spaghetti, stew, fajitas, and omelettes are staples, and with little to no modification can be dairy and soy-free. Don't feel like you need to reinvent the wheel. - Experiment with snacks. Some dairy and soy-free alternatives are delicious, some are less delicious. Try a few new things and see what you like. - Start cooking. Dietary restrictions like allergies can make eating out tricky. Even if foods are safe, restaurants run the risk of cross-contamination. We've been fortunate to find 2 restaurants local to us that we feel safe ordering from, but outside of those, we cook at home. Have any questions?
